Renaissance Florence Route: Politics, Patronage, Power

Use a chronology-first museum strategy to decode Florence's civic and dynastic history.

Do not organize your trip by popularity. Organize it by historical sequence.

Four Phases

  1. Commune and guild authority.
  2. Early Renaissance experimentation.
  3. Medici consolidation and display.
  4. Grand Duchy continuity and curation.

Site Pairing Grid

Theme Pairing
Civic authority Palazzo Vecchio + civic core
Artistic contest Baptistery context + sculpture rooms
Dynastic display Uffizi + Pitti
Landscape control Boboli narrative axis

Ask not only what is beautiful, but what is being communicated.

Museum Micro-Questions

  • Who paid for this work?
  • Who was the intended audience?
  • What political message is hidden in style and placement?

Bottom line

A Florence pass becomes a historical decoder when your route is chronological.
